Renault seeks performance boost with new engine

Renault manager Cyril Abiteboul has said the Formula One team is preparing a new platform for its engine, including technology yet to debut on the track. “I prefer to be conservative in the expectation for the first initial running of the engine at the start of the season,” Abiteboul told f1technical. “It is an engine that offers the potential to cope with an awful lot of development.
